A Poem by matrix101

Darkness upon Darkness,
the Night has fallen,
Surrounded by beauty,
On a Cold Winters Night.

The Moon gives light,
as I walk through the woods,
Surrounded by beauty as my eyes are in awe.

Mountain ash trees & weltered bark,
a picturesque lake not far away,
a Blue stone wall with Iron gates,
Lay memories from those before.

Enslaved are my eyes for what stands before me,
Like scattered pearls untouched by man,
from the skies above on this mysterious night,
Tranquility descends that envelopes our minds.

Like strangers we stand as our souls connect,
for they have once met in a life before,
our eyes speak of unspoken words,
as my heart beats the closer she draws.

Surrounded by Creatures in the shadows of Night,
I held her tight like vulnerable prey,
depart we did as our Souls remained,
Dancing to the sounds of the Cold Winters Night.
